VERSAILLES — Officials at Versailles Health Care Center invite the public to its quarterly event for survivors of stroke and brain injury and their families. NeuroConnect meets to connect survivors and their families with positive support and beneficial resources.

The next NeuroConnect will be held on Thursday at 4 p.m. at Versailles Health Care Center. The guest speaker will be Carol Gigandet of Versailles. Her husband, Roger, is a survivor of a stroke in 2015. She will share their story.

As usual, the event will be led by Dr. Stephen Winner, facility rehab director and physical therapist, and Tammy Moyar, Certified Occupational Therapy Assistant.

This is a free meeting for survivors of stroke and brain injury and their families. Light snacks and beverages will be provided.
